Good when you want quick and convenient
The Freshness Burger Shimokitaza branch is located super close to Shimokitazawa Station (just two minutes away on foot), and while it's probably not going to be the most exciting burger you'll ever eat, they do a couple of things well -- speed and reliability. They've got a solid lineup of burgers on their regular menu, but they also often have seasonal specials as well if you're looking for something new and different to try. I also like that they have a dedicated kids menu with smaller-sized burger offerings + potato wedges + juice.

The spicy crispy chicken burger was a temptation!
Prepare for the temptation by deciding ahead what to order when you get in at Freshness Burger. Aside from the classic burgers, you have options to order hamburgers, chicken burgers or hotdogs. But yesterday, I went for their spicy crispy chicken. It was the bomb! The chicken was hot, crunchy and perfectly nongreasy. It’s just difficult to resist. For 460yen paired with onion rings and draft beer, that brings about 1,200 yen. No bad, right?
